Description : What is meant by voltage follower?

Last Answer : If the output voltage of an op-amp follows the input i.e., if the output voltage is equal to the input voltage it is called as a voltage follower.

Description : State the reason of using roller follower over kinfe edge follower.

Last Answer : 1) Roller follower has less wear and tear than knife edge follower. 2) Power required for driving the cam is less due to less frictional force between cam and follower.

Description : List any four applications of ‘cam’ and ‘follower’.

Last Answer : Applications of Cam and Follower: [1] Operating the inlet and exhaust valves of internal combustion engines [2] Used in Automatic attachment of machineries, paper cutting machines [3] Used in Spinning ... control mechanism [7] Used in wall clock [8] Used in feed mechanism of automatic lathe.
